- 1、本文档共51页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
1
2017-4-10
系统工程
第三章 系统的优化算法
第一节 基于遗传算法的随机优化搜索
1.1 基本概念
1.2 基本遗传算法
1.3 遗传算法应用举例
1.4 遗传算法的特点与优势
1.5 基于实数编码的加速遗传算法
2017-4-10
3
遗传算法概述
遗传算法(genetic algorithm ,简称GA)是由美国J.H.Holland于1975年提出的一种全新的优化搜索算法。GA发展初期,并没有引起学术界的关注,因而发展比较缓慢,直到八十年代,GA的研究才引起重视并逐步成熟起来,目前,已在组合优化、机器学习、自适应控制、模式识别、神经网络、经济预测等领域取得了令人瞩目的应用成果。
2017-4-10
4
算法的学说:
(1)遗传:“种瓜得瓜,种豆得豆”,亲代把生物信息交给子代,子代按照所得信息而发育、分化,子代总是和亲代具有相同或相似的性状。
(2)变异: 亲代和子代之间以及子代的不同个体之间总有差异。变异是随机发生的,变异的选择和积累是生命多样性的根源。
(3)生存斗争和适者生存:由于弱肉强食和生存斗争不断进行,其结果是适者生存,不适者被淘汰,通过一代代的选择作用,物种变异朝着一个方向积累,演变为新的物种。
2017-4-10
5
基本思想——遗传进化,根据自然选择和适者生存原理,用简单的编码技术和繁殖机制,模拟自然界生物群体优胜劣汰的进化过程,实现对复杂问题的求解。
把搜索空间(欲求解问题的解空间)映射为遗传空间,把每一个可能的解编码为一个向量(二进制或十进制数字串),称为一个染色体(或个体),向量中每一个元素称为基因。
所有染色体组成群体(群体中染色体个数用POP表示),并按预定的目标函数(或某种评价指标)对每个染色体进行评价,根据其结果给出一个适应度值。
遗传算法的实现
2017-4-10
6
算法开始时,先随机地产生一些染色体(欲求解问题的候选解),计算其适应度,根据适应度对诸染色体进行选择、交叉、变异操作,剔除适应度差的染色体,留下适应度较好(性能优良)的染色体,从而得到新的群体。
新群体的染色体是上一代群体的优秀者,继承了上一代的优良性态,因而明显优于上一代,这样就能向着更优解的方向进化,直至满足某种预定的优化收敛指标。
2017-4-10
7
1.1 基本概念
1. 个体与种群
● 个体就是模拟生物个体而对问题中的对象
(一般就是问题的解)的一种称呼,一个个
体也就是搜索空间中的一个点。
● 种群(population)就是模拟生物种群而由若
干个体组成的群体, 它一般是整个搜索空间
的一个很小的子集。
2017-4-10
8
2. 适应度与适应度函数
● 适应度(fitness)就是借鉴生物个体对环境的
适应程度,而对问题中的个体对象所设计的表征其优劣的一种测度。
● 适应度函数(fitness function)就是问题中的 全体个体与其适应度之间的一个对应关系。 它一般是一个实值函数。该函数就是遗传算 法中指导搜索的评价函数。
2017-4-10
9
3. 染色体与基因
染色体(chromosome)就是问题中个体的某种字符串形式的编码表示。字符串中的字符也就称为基因(gene)。
例如:
个体 染色体
9 ---- 1001
(2,5,6)---- 010 101 110
2017-4-10
10
4. 遗传操作
亦称遗传算子(genetic operator),就是关于染色体的运算。遗传算法中有三种遗传操作:
● 选择-复制(selection-reproduction)
● 交叉(crossover,亦称交换、交配或杂交)
● 变异(mutation,亦称突变)
2017-4-10
11
选择-复制 通常做法是:对于一个规模为N的种群S,每个染色体xi∈S具有一定的选择概率P(xi)所决定的选中机会, 分N次从S中随机选定N个染色体, 并进行复制。
父代个体的数量
2017-4-10
12
交叉 就是互换两个染色体某些位上的基因。
s1′ s2′可以看做是原染色体s1和s2的子代染色体。
染色体 s1 s2 交换其后4位基因, 即
2017-4-10
13
变异 就是
您可能关注的文档
- 第3章畜产食品原料第六部分蛋与蛋制品要点.ppt
- 第7章-1啤酒酿造(16学时)要点.ppt
- 第3章畜产食品原料第一部分畜禽种类及品种要点.ppt
- 第3章存储设备要点.ppt
- 第7章测序要点.ppt
- 第7章沉淀平衡及在定量中的应用要点.ppt
- 第7章醇酚醚(新)要点.ppt
- 第7章地壳运动的原因要点.ppt
- 第3章蛋白质化学01(功能-氨基酸-肽-分类)要点.ppt
- 第7章第二节2隔离与物种的形成要点.ppt
- 【Jefferies-2025研报】珀莱雅(603605):首席财务官突然(提前)离职.pdf
- 【Jefferies-2025研报】安全散货船公司(SB):第一季度业绩超预期;完成回购计划,合同现金流支撑业绩.pdf
- 【Jefferies-2025研报】高级公共有限公司(SNR):初步观点Senior plc - Flexonics部门两项合同公告,价值约2亿欧元.pdf
- 二零二五年度北京二手房交易定金协议样本.docx
- 二零二五年度保密协议书[技术交流版].docx
- 二零二五年度主播内容创作合同.docx
- 二零二五年度仓储租赁及安全防护协议.docx
- 二零二五年度健身中心场地租赁及会员服务协议.docx
- 二零二五年度创城墙面粉刷项目经费—施工方承包协议.docx
- 二零二五年度保洁设备采购与绿色清洁服务合同.docx
文档评论(0)